Surgical technologists can find employment in various healthcare settings, including hospitals, outpatient care centers, and ambulatory surgery centers.Sep 6, 2023 · Surgical technologists, also called operating room technicians, prepare operating rooms, arrange equipment, and help doctors and first assistants during surgeries. Duties. Surgical technologists typically do the following: Prepare operating rooms for surgery; Sterilize equipment and make sure that there are adequate supplies for surgery

The Association of Surgical Technologists was established in 1969 by members of the American College of Surgeons (ACS), the American Hospital Association (AHA), and the Association of periOperative Registered Nurses (AORN). Both the CST and TS-C (NCCT) certifications require surgical technologists to complete continuing education to maintain their certification.10.
